ORDER
This writ petition has been filed by the petitioner seeking a direction to the first respondent to consider the appeal memorandum dated 03.08.2015, by promoting him as Co-operative Sub-Registrar on par with his junior on merits.
2. The case of the petitioner is as follows:
The petitioner was initially appointed as Junior Inspector of Co-operative Societies. Subsequently, he was promoted as Senior Inspector of Co-operative Societies in
Villupuram District, on 01.05.2007. Thereafter, he made an appeal/representation to the Joint Registrar, Villupuram, seeking inclusion of his name in the panel drawn for promotion to the post of Sub Registrar. The Joint Registrar, Villupuram stated that he must complete three years of service in the category of Senior Inspector, therefore, his name could not be recommended.
3. According to the petitioner, as on 01.05.2011, his coworker was promoted as Co-operative Sub-Registrar. Hence, the petitioner made an appeal/representation dated 03.08.2015 to the respondents, seeking to promote him as Co-operative SubRegistrar on par with his co-worker. The said appeal/representation has not been considered till date. Hence, the petitioner has come forward with the present petition.
4. The learned counsel appearing for the petitioner submitted that the petitioner would be satisfied, if the respondents are directed to consider the appeal/representation made by him on 03.08.2015 on merits and in accordance with law.
5. The learned Government Advocate would submit that at the time of preparation of panel, he was not eligible to the post of Co-operative Sub-Registrar, as he has not completed three years of service in the category of Senior Inspector as on 01.05.2010. However, in view of subsequent development, the first respondent would consider the appeal of the petitioner dated 03.08.2015, on merits.
6. In view of the submission made by the learned Government Advocate, the first respondent is directed to consider the petitioner's appeal/representation dated 03.08.2015 and pass orders on merits and in accordance with law, as expeditiously as possible.
7. With the above direction, the present writ petition is disposed of. No costs.
